It Happened One Summer by Tessa Bailey

In It Happened One Summer by Tessa Bailey ($13), social media influencer and Hollywood socialite Piper Bellinger has a tendency to take things too far — which is exactly how she ends up banished to a small fishing town following one wild night. Left to fend for herself with a meager allowance from her wealthy stepdad, she's determined to prove to her family — and the town's hot sea captain Brendan Taggart — just how wrong they all were about her.

Why It's Memorable: This book blew up on BookTok this year, and for good reason. Sometimes, you just need a good, traditional alpha-male-hero-courts-reluctant-heroine storyline. Brendan is fierce in how much he wants a serious relationship with Piper that isn't just physical. Meanwhile, Piper is very much on the fence about commitment and just wants to make things about sex. That dynamic — her pushing him to his limits and him trying his hardest to remain a gentleman — makes for some steamy scenes. If you thought Champagne was a sexy drink, the first almost-sex scene will just confirm it.
